L’Oréal Paris Infallible Concealer 🤎

Full coverage without making your makeup feel complicated.

This concealer is made for high coverage, so it’s a good option when you want to cover dark circles, blemishes, or imperfections while keeping your base looking polished.

✨ What I Like

  • High coverage
  • Helps hide dark circles & blemishes
  • Long-wearing formula
  • Great for a more finished makeup look

🤔 What to Keep in Mind

Because it has fuller coverage, less is more. Applying too much can make the under-eye area look heavy or emphasize texture, especially if your skin is dry.

💭 Vandana’s Take

For me, this is more of a “I want my makeup to last” concealer rather than a super-natural, barely-there one. If you’re looking for coverage that can handle a long day, it’s definitely one to consider. ♡

My Rating: ⭐ 4/5

Best for: Medium–full coverage
Finish: Natural-looking
Best use: Dark circles & blemishes
Worth trying? Yes, especially for full-coverage makeup.

Maybelline Colossal Waterproof Mascara 💛

A classic for everyday lashes.

Maybelline Colossal is all about giving your lashes more volume and definition, while its waterproof formula helps it stay put through a long day.

✨ What I Like

  • Adds noticeable volume

  • Waterproof

  • Good for everyday makeup

  • Classic, easy-to-use formula

🤔 What to Keep in Mind

The waterproof formula can make it a little harder to remove, so you’ll need a good eye-makeup remover. If you prefer a very natural lash look, you may also find it a bit too bold.

💭 Vandana’s Take

If you’re someone who wants defined, fuller-looking lashes without spending ages on eye makeup, this is a reliable everyday option. 💛

My Rating: ⭐ 4/5

Best for: Volume & everyday wear
Finish: Bold & defined
Formula: Waterproof
Worth trying? Yes, especially for long days or humid weather.

 

The Derma Co 2% Sali-Cinamide Face Wash 💙

A simple pick for oily & acne-prone skin.

With 2% Salicylic Acid + 2% Niacinamide, this face wash is designed to help with excess oil, clogged pores, and acne-prone skin.

✨ What I Like

  • Helps remove excess oil
  • Contains salicylic acid for pore cleansing
  • Niacinamide supports the skin barrier
  • Great for oily & acne-prone skin

🤔 What to Keep in Mind

It may feel drying if overused, especially if your skin is sensitive or already dry. Start slowly and see how your skin responds.

💭 Vandana’s Take

As someone with oily skin, ingredients like salicylic acid are always interesting to me. I like that this combines oil-control with niacinamide, rather than focusing only on stripping away oil.

My Rating: ⭐ 4/5

Best for: Oily & acne-prone skin
Key ingredients: 2% Salicylic Acid + 2% Niacinamide
Worth trying? Yes, if excess oil and clogged pores are your main concerns. ♡
